Arabian Divas: The Enchanting Voices of Female Singers168
The captivating melodies of Arabic music have long captivated audiences worldwide, and at the heart of this musical tapestry are the enchanting voices of female singers. From traditional Arabic melodies to contemporary pop anthems, these divas have left an indelible mark on the music industry, showcasing the rich cultural heritage and boundless creativity of the Arab world.
Umm Kulthum, often hailed as the "Star of the East," remains a timeless icon in the annals of Arabic music. Her unparalleled vocal range and emotional depth captivated generations of listeners, earning her the title "Lady of Arabic Singing." Her performances were legendary events, with audiences spellbound by her mellifluous voice and mesmerizing stage presence.
Fairuz, the "Nightingale of Lebanon," is another luminary of Arabic music. Her songs evoke the beauty and longing of her homeland, with her voice soaring effortlessly over intricate melodies. Fairuz's music transcends cultural boundaries, appealing to listeners from all walks of life with its poetic lyrics and timeless charm.
Asmahan, known as the "Arab Rose," was a trailblazing vocalist and actress who captivated audiences in the 1940s. Her voice possessed a unique blend of strength and vulnerability, perfectly suited for the emotional intensity of Arabic love songs. Asmahan's tragic death at a young age only cemented her status as a legend in Arabic music.
